@ Matt Price: There's clearly something weird about the way the rtl8192 module was added to the ubuntu source tree It seems to be based on a different version. Yours is version 0015 (released on the 11th of March), while in the Ubuntu kernel version 0014 is used instead. The files under linux-2.6.32/ubuntu/rtl8192se correspond to the ones under rtl8192se-2.6.0015.0127.2010/HAL/rtl8192 in your dkms package -- which are indeed the ones compiled into the .ko according to your Makefile. If you diff the files in those directories ('-bB' to eliminate rubbish), you'll see lots of small changes. I think what we basically want here is the ubuntu module to be rebased against version 0015 from Realtek, which appears to work reliably. -- [LUCID] EEEPC-1201N missing RTL8192SE module required for wifi card https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/530275 You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u Bugs, which is subscribed to Ubuntu. -- ubuntu-bugs mailing list ubuntu-bugs@lists.ubuntu.com https://lists.ubuntu.com/mailman/listinfo/ubuntu-bugs
